Use LiveKit's Rust SDK on Linux while continue using Swift SDK on Mac (#21550)

Similar to #20826 but keeps the Swift implementation. There were quite a
few changes in the `call` crate, and so that code now has two variants.

Closes #13714

Release Notes:

- Added preliminary Linux support for voice chat and viewing
screenshares.
